How to Fix Windows.Security.Authentication.OnlineId.dll Missing Error (Solved)
What is Windows.Security.Authentication.OnlineId.dll?
Windows.Security.Authentication.OnlineId.dll is a Dynamic Link Library (DLL) file which is an essential component of the Windows operating system. It plays a critical role in handling the authentication process for online identities particularly those related to Microsoft services.
Why is Windows.Security.Authentication.OnlineId.dll missing?
The missing Windows.Security.Authentication.OnlineId.dll error can be caused by various reasons such as malware infection accidental deletion or corrupted system files during the installation or update of other applications.
Step-by-Step Fixes:
Method 1: Reinstall Visual C++ Redistributable
The Windows.Security.Authentication.OnlineId.dll file is associated with Microsoft Visual C++ Redistributable so reinstalling this package may resolve the issue.
- Visit the official Microsoft Download Center at this link.
- Download and run the Visual C++ Redistributable package that matches your Windows version (x64 or x86).
- Follow the on-screen instructions to complete the installation process.
Method 2: Run SFC /scannow command
Running an System File Checker (SFC) scan can help fix corrupted system files including the missing Windows.Security.Authentication.OnlineId.dll file.
- Open Command Prompt as an administrator by searching “cmd” in the Start menu right-clicking on the result and selecting “Run as administrator”.
- Type the following command and press Enter:
sfc /scannow - Follow the on-screen instructions to complete the scan.
Method 3: Update System Drivers
Outdated system drivers can cause various issues including missing DLL files. Updating them may help resolve the problem.
- Press Win + X and select “Device Manager” from the menu.
- Locate the device for which you want to update the driver right-click on it and select “Update Driver”.
- Choose “Search automatically for updated driver software” and follow the instructions to complete the process.
Conclusion
By following these step-by-step fixes you should be able to resolve the Windows.Security.Authentication.OnlineId.dll missing error on your Windows system.